Using smart strategies with pandas lets you work with big data efficiently. You can load data in chunks, filter before loading, and use memory-friendly data types. This way, your computer stays fast, and you get accurate results without hassle.
data = pd.read_csv('bigfile.csv') # tries to load all at once
for chunk in pd.read_csv('bigfile.csv', chunksize=100000): # process piece by piece process(chunk)
